On Tuesday, December 21, 2021, Phyllis Smith via Cin < cin@lists.cinelerra-gg.org> wrote:
> Andrew, some problems/feedback and I have attached the > thirdparty/Makefile based on current GIT + 0004-TEST (some manual editing) > so you can see > What are all of these changes with "autoreconf" for? > > Old libraries (like libraw1394..) from thirdparty tend to have older autotools-based build system. This build system tend to fail on unknown architectures (like aarch64.. or Powerpc64-le) even if library's code builds fine. This sequence of calls was found while building for Elbrus architecture and I think it will be useful for at least making build progress further on all those new arches like e2k, ppc64(le), aarch64, risc-v.. > > > > > This builds, BUT I have no way to test them: > > *0002-Test-try-to-fix-autoreconf-in-libav1394.patch * > > *0004-TEST-autoreconf-for-**thirdparty-libs-for-new-**arches.patch* > The above patch fails so far with: > make[2]: *** [Makefile:353: /tmp/cin5/cinelerra-5.1/ > thirdparty/../thirdparty/build/libdv.configure] Error2 > And before that had to fix line: > + libiec61883.cflags?="$(call inc_path,libraw1394)" > to remove the blank space between the "+" and "libiec..." > oh, probably damaged patch (it still builds for me..) > > You already removed this patch which fails to build and I do not see any > replacement so skipping: > *0003-fix-dav1d-0.5.1-patch-non-x86-incompatible-atm.patch* > make[2]: *** [Makefile:341: /tmp/cin5/cinelerra-5.1/ > thirdparty/../thirdparty/build/dav1d.built] Error 2 > yeah, you can skip this one, sorry. > On Wed, Dec 15, 2021 at 5:37 AM Andrew Randrianasulu via Cin < > cin@lists.cinelerra-gg.org> wrote: > >> you probably can just remove 'less build in openexr 2.4.1' patch from >> folder with patches and add 0011 from this series .. >> >> sorry for trouble (it seems clang-13 compiles this just fine..) >> >> On Wednesday, December 15, 2021, Andrew Randrianasulu < >> randrianas...@gmail.com> wrote: >> >>> ow, this is https://www.cinelerra-gg.org/bugtracker/view.php?id=543 >>> resurfacing >>> >>> i probably named my openexr patch wrongly. can you remove (unapply) >>> openexr part of series? >>> >>> On Wednesday, December 15, 2021, Andrea paz <gamberucci.and...@gmail.com> >>> wrote: >>> >>>> Build error (not the same). >>>> >>> -- >> Cin mailing list >> Cin@lists.cinelerra-gg.org >> https://lists.cinelerra-gg.org/mailman/listinfo/cin >> >
-- Cin mailing list Cin@lists.cinelerra-gg.org https://lists.cinelerra-gg.org/mailman/listinfo/cin